Drew Roy Absent from Hannah Montana 20th Anniversary Special

drew roy — US news

Drew Roy, who gained fame as Jesse on Hannah Montana from 2009 to 2011, has undergone a significant career transformation. Previously, fans expected to see him at the show’s 20th Anniversary Special on March 24, 2026, but he was notably absent.

This absence marks a decisive moment in Roy’s life, as he has shifted his focus from acting to aviation. In February 2025, he became a qualified jet pilot and joined Delta Air Lines as a First Officer after six years of rigorous training. His Instagram reflects this new priority, showcasing his passion for flying and family life.

The direct effects of this shift are evident in Roy’s personal and professional life. He celebrated his 10-year wedding anniversary with his wife, Renee Roy, in December 2025, and they have two sons, Jack and Levi. Renee has publicly expressed her pride in Drew’s accomplishments, stating, “I am so proud of this man! What you have accomplished in the last 6 years, most cannot do in a lifetime.”

Roy’s last acting role was in 2021, where he reprised his character Griffin on iCarly. Since then, he has distanced himself from the entertainment industry, focusing instead on his aviation career and family responsibilities.
